Ness Sinfonia

Inverness Cathedral and the Ness Sinfonia present Remembering Absent Friends: A Celebration for Special People

This celebration will focus on celebrating the wonderful people who we have been privileged to know in our lives but who are sadly no longer with us, using a mixture of readings, music and songs including some for everyone to join in. There will be tea afterwards.

Saturday 18 November, 3pm - 5pm. Free (including tea)
Inverness Cathedral, 15 Ardoss Street, Inverness, IV3 5NS

Hibernian Football Club

Word cloudAt the Hibernian v St Johnstone match on Saturday 18 November, fans of the club will be remembering their absent friends with a tribute wall. Posters will be places around the stadium for fans to leave written or photo tributes to Hibs fans who have died.l Last year, fans filled 130 posters with over 500 individual tributes and photos.

Saturday 18 November 2017, 3pm
Hibernian FC, Easter Road Stadium, Edinburgh, EH7 5QG

Ecumenical Service of Remembrance

St Alphonsus Church

FASS (Family Addiction Support Service) invite you to an ecumenical service of remembrance for those who have died through drug or alcohol related problems.

The service will be led by Father Ian Bathgate of St Alphonsus Church and Rev Peter Davidge of Gallowgate Parish Church, and will be opened by Aileen Campbell MSP, Minister for Public Health and Sport.

There will be light refreshments afterwards in the Lodging House Mission, 35 East Campbell Street.

For enquiries, e-mail info@fassglasgow.org

Thursday 23 November, 7.30pm
St Alphonsus Church, London Road, Glasgow, G40
